VIDEO: Lagos Mechanic Laments Loss of N125,000 After Helping Stranded Woman Deliver Baby

A Lagos-based mechanic, Emmanuel Enya, has recounted how his act of kindness in helping a stranded pregnant woman deliver her baby turned painful after N125,000 meant for their care was allegedly stolen by bystanders.

Enya was travelling from Kwara State towards the Ojota area of Lagos when he spotted the distressed woman by the roadside. Realising she was in labour, he made a U-turn to assist and successfully helped deliver the baby.

While the mother and child were safe, Enya said the cash he had set aside for essential items for them was taken in the commotion. He described the incident as deeply painful, lamenting what he sees as a decline in societal humanity despite his efforts to save a life.
